In an alternating current circuit consisting of elements in series, the current increases on increasing the frequency of supply. Which of the following elements are likely to constitute the circuit?
पर्याय
Only resistor
Resistor and an inductor
Resistor and an capacitor
Only a capacitor

उत्तर
Resistor and an capacitor and Only a capacitor
Explanation:
Here in question on increasing the frequency (f), the current also increases. But resistance does not depend on frequency. So on increasing frequency XC decreases to increase current in circuit. Therefore, circuit must have a capacitor; however, it may there may not be a resistor.
